University of Prishtina is pleased to announce that they will organize the 13th edition of Prishtina International Summer University, which will hold from 22 July-2 August 2013. The Summer University will be offering twenty credited courses covering a wide range of study fields such as social sciences, law, economics, arts, education, medicine, engineering, linguistics, agronomics, archaeology etc.
About UPISU
The University of Prishtina International Summer University (UPISU) is organized by the University of Prishitna in cooperation with various donators and partners. The aim of the UPISU is to create direct links to regional and international Universities as well as increase scientific research capacities. The summer univesity gathers academics, professsors and students from all around the world to ensure the exchange of their scientific experiences and the possibility to learn more about Kosova.

Benefits
- A modest allowance of 500 EUR will be paid to selected visiting professors for the whole course.
- The UP does not cover costs for (additional health, molest or travel) insurance.
- Once you have been selected as a visiting professor,UPISU staff will purchase your ticket as soon as possible in order to contain the expenses made for travel reimbursements (during previous years late bookings resulted in extraordinary high prices for airfare). In case of impossibility of UPISU staff to provide you with tickets, you can purchase your ticket. (The maximum amounts that can be reimbursed on ticket booking are 500 Euro for Europe; 1200 Euro for North America and 1800 for Australia.These amounts include all travel arrangements, e.g. tickets, hotel, etc). Any costs that are not reasonably related to traveling to the UPISU directly will not be reimbursed, e.g. unnecessary long stop overs, and subsequently, high hotel costs.
- UPISU staff will make housing arrangements. Visiting professors will stay in a dormitory . Accommodation costs will be covered by the organization. You will share your accommodation with other visiting professors.
